Members are allowed 90 minutes to edit their posts, which is a very generous amount of time to read over your posts to figure out if you need to edit it or not.

There can be problems with members having longer times to edit their posts, including continuity of conversations.

The time limit cannot be changed on a per usergroup basis.

I can appreciate making a type, but most people won't care about that. Some people go back and change their content, which is what can be confusing. The time limit allows enough time for editing, but then figures after a while you can just make a new post.

As I said, it is not configurable by usergroup. Thus, even getting a subscription will not make a difference for this feature. Only a mod or admin can edit a post after the time period has elapsed.
